The free boundary for a superlinear system

Abstract
In this paper, we study superlinear systems that give rise to free boundaries. Such systems appear for example from the minimization of the energy functional but solutions can be also understood in an ad hoc viscosity way. First, we prove the optimal regularity of minimizers using a variational approach. Then, we apply a linearization technique to establish the -regularity of the ``flat'' part of the free boundary via a viscosity method. Finally, for minimizing free boundaries, we extend this result to analyticity.
